| 14 | +TI - Genetic analysis and fine mapping reveal that AhRt3, which encodes an anthocyanin |
| 15 | + reductase, is responsible for red testa in cultivated peanuts. |
| 16 | +PG - 117 |
| 17 | +LID - 10.1007/s00122-025-04903-1 [doi] |
| 18 | +AB - AhRt3, which governs the red testa of peanut, was narrowed down to a 125.30 kb |
| 19 | + region, and one gene encoding anthocyanin reductase was identified as the |
| 20 | + putative candidate gene. Testa color is a special characteristic of peanuts |
| 21 | + (Arachis hypogaea L.), and those with dark testa have been focused on recent |
| 22 | + years owing to their high-anthocyanin content and increased antioxidant |
| 23 | + nutritional value. However, the genetic mechanisms underlying this trait remain |
| 24 | + limited. To identify the gene responsible for the red testa color in peanuts, an |
| 25 | + F(2) population was constructed by crossing YH91 (pink testa) with JHT1 (red |
| 26 | + testa). Genetic analysis revealed that the red testa was controlled by a single |
| 27 | + dominant gene named AhRt3 (Arachis hypogaea Red Testa 3). Through bulked |
| 28 | + segregant analysis sequencing, AhRt3 was preliminarily mapped to the chromosome |
| 29 | + Arahy.03 and subsequently narrowed to a 125.30 kb genomic region containing 12 |
| 30 | + potential candidate genes. RNA-seq analysis revealed that 4,880 genes were |
| 31 | + differentially expressed in the seed testa, with only the candidate gene |
| 32 | + Arahy.W8TDEC exhibiting higher expression levels in JHT1 than in YH91. |
| 33 | + Additionally, sequence variation, functional annotation, and expression profiling |
| 34 | + confirmed that Arahy.W8TDEC, which encodes an anthocyanin reductase, may be a |
| 35 | + candidate gene for AhRt3. The structural variation involving an inversion between |
| 36 | + the sixth exon and the 3'UTR of Arahy.W8TDEC resulted in altered amino acids |
| 37 | + closely associated with the red testa phenotype in peanuts. In conclusion, this |
| 38 | + study highlights the role of a novel gene in regulating red testa and contributes |
| 39 | + valuable insights into the genetic basis of seed testa in peanuts. |
